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Rewrite release signing pipeline #1408

Merged
merged 8 commits into from
Feb 3, 2021
Merged

Rewrite release signing pipeline #1408

merged 8 commits into from
Feb 3, 2021

Conversation

andyleejordan
Copy link
Member

@andyleejordan andyleejordan commented Feb 2, 2021

This changes a bunch of internal stuff to use "ESRP" signing instead of "Package ES" signing, which only matters to Microsoft folks.

Resolves #1409.

This isn't done, but I need to start a pipeline run to see where it's at.
This includes removing the file catalog steps entirely,
as we presumably do not need it.
Also fix upload of artifacts to include everything.
.vsts-ci/templates/release-general.yml Outdated Show resolved Hide resolved
@ghost ghost added Area-Build & Release Issue-Enhancement A feature request (enhancement). labels Feb 2, 2021
And sign third-party libraries, which negates the need to setup malware
scanning (since signed binaries are scanned automatically).
@andyleejordan andyleejordan changed the title Rewrite release build pipeline Rewrite release signing pipeline Feb 3, 2021
@andyleejordan andyleejordan merged commit 29e44b6 into master Feb 3, 2021
@andyleejordan andyleejordan deleted the andschwa/esrp branch February 3, 2021 22:20
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Area-Build & Release Issue-Enhancement A feature request (enhancement).
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Rewrite release signing pipeline
3 participants